Brittany Ferries and Islands Unlimited join forces to offer new passenger ferry link between Guernsey and Jersey

High-speedBrittany Ferries and Channel Islands-based ferry operator Islands Unlimited have joined forces to operate a new inter-island passenger ferry service between Guernsey and Jersey. The service started in early March.

Under the new agreement, Islands Unlimited’s services will operate for up to five days a week between St. Peter Port and St. Helier from March through to October. The new service will be available through Brittany Ferries reservations and website.

Brittany Ferries currently operates its own service between Guernsey and Jersey on a Wednesday.

Islands Unlimited launched its Guernsey-Jersey service in summer 2025 and operates the 330-passenger capacity air-cushion (Surface Effect Ship – SES) catamaran ferry SAN PAWL on the route. This 35m vessel was built in 1990 and was acquired from Malta’s Virtu Ferries in April 2025.
